Struggling NHL coach turns to ChatGPT as Calgary Flames search for answers
Calgary's professional hockey team, the Flames, is facing one of the worst starts in franchise history. Fourteen games into the National Hockey League season, they have managed only three wins – a record that has left them buried near the bottom of the standings and searching for solutions. Tesla shareholders approve $1 trillion pay package for Elon Musk
Tesla shareholders have approved a compensation package worth nearly $1 trillion for CEO Elon Musk. Results announced Thursday at the annual shareholder meeting in Austin, Texas, showed that roughly 75 percent of voting shares supported the plan, which ties Musk's pay to ambitious long-term stock and operational milestones.
